Why clean the engine of your Nissan Cabstar?

So we begin our article by explaining why it might be good to consider a cleaning of the engine block of your Nissan Cabstar .

The most basic motive for cleaning the engine compartment of your motor vehicle should be frequent service. Failing to clean your motor vehicle will bring about dirt and grime to accumulate and sooner or later harm parts of your motor vehicle. We suggest you to perform this cleaning between 1 and 2 times a year. It can as well be interesting to clean your engine before selling your Nissan Cabstar, however be careful not to clean it too much, potential buyers might believe that a too clean engine is associated with a leaking engine that tries to be camouflaged by a complete cleaning, better to have a healthy engine than a too clean engine.

To prepare the engine of your Nissan Cabstar before cleaning it

.
First step and not the least necessary one. Even if your car’s engine compartment is supposed to be waterproof, cleaning it totally is not advised either because of the many electrical components inside. Therefore, before you clean the engine of your Nissan Cabstar completely, it is better to protect the electrical components of your Nissan Cabstar . Here are the steps to take to protect your car’s engine properly:

  • Disconnect and remove the battery from your Nissan Cabstar , to achieve this, do not hesitate to consult our article dedicated to this subject if you don’t know how to achieve this step.
  • Take out the upper motor housing of your Nissan Cabstar , it’s a plastic cover that can generally be removed by unscrewing a few screws. This will let you to have an much easier access to the whole engine of your motor vehicle.
  • Protect all electrical components with plastic film , stretchable for example, this includes the flowmeter (which is located on your air inlet), the alternator, all electrical cables and the fuse box

Cleaning of the engine compartment of a Nissan Cabstar

Now that you have prepared your motor vehicle for cleaning, all you have to do is start cleaning it, here are the steps to stick to to clean the engine of your Nissan Cabstar properly :

  • Warm up the engine of your motor vehicle for about 5 minutes, this will produce the grease more fluid and facilitate its elimination.
  • Use a strong> engine degreaser and spray generously on all visible parts of your Nissan Cabstar engine.
  • Let it work for five to ten minutes.
  • Do not use a high-pressure cleaner, as this may affect components of your engine. So use a garden hose and rise with a lot of water.
  • If you are satisfied with the result, you can dry your engine with a compressor, if there are traces of grease remaining, you can replicate the procedure until it disappears.
  • Last little piece of suggestions, if you want and have the budget, you can apply a layer of motor protection, this will prevent the accumulation of dirt on the engine of your Nissan Cabstar, you will find this sort of product in specialised shops or in the category of products for boat motors

.
All you have to do is clean the work area, refit your engine crankcase, reconnect your battery and you’ll have the ability to get back on the road with a clean engine.
